wicked wrote: | I just wanted to find out if any one had some experience using the TomTom One as a multi-drop planning device?
| No, not much. No route optimisation is possible, the points are visited as you enter them. I would suggest Autoroute on a PC, then ITNConv.
wicked wrote: | It looks like you cannot enter full postcodes but need to enter a partial postcode and find the road name?
| To enter a full postcode, in Itinerary Planning, tap Add, then tap next page, then tap Postcode. _________________ Jock
